The Roman Catholic Diocese of Fontibón (Latin: Fontibonensis) is a diocese located in the city of Fontibón in the Ecclesiastical province of Bogotá in Colombia.

History

  • 6 August 2003: Established as Diocese of Fontibón from Metropolitan Archdiocese of Bogotá

Ordinaries

  • Enrique Sarmiento Angulo (2003.08.06 – 2011.11.25)
  • Juan Vicente Cordoba Villota, S.J. (2011.11.25 – present)
